'With an analysis of Norman Lear's sitcoms, this volume explores his production career during the 1970s. It emphasizes how Lear's shows reflected the political and cultural milieu, and how they addressed societal issues including racism, child abuse and gun control. Interviews with some of the actors and actresses such as Rue McClanahan and Marla Gibbs are included'--Provided by publisher.
